(CNS): The 2013/2014 track season will begin next weekend with the staging of the new Damion Rose Sprint & Distance Track Meet at the Truman Bodden Sports Complex. Athletes interested in competing in the memorial event are asked to register as soon as possible. This meet is dedicated to the memory of Damion Rose, one of our fallen athletes who drowned off Public Beach on Sunday, 20 October he was a talented athlete who touched many lives in and out of the track & field arena; he will be missed by all. The meet starts at 9am on Saturday, 7 December and includes Javelin, Long Jump, Discus, 3000m, 150m, 1000m, 600m, 1600m and 300m.
